Gwangju-Jeonnam Power Outages Spike Ahead of 800 Trillion Won Chip Hub
Aging infrastructure and capacity overloads are driving grid instability just as South Korea plans a massive semiconductor cluster in the region.
The Gwangju-Jeonnam region has recorded the highest number of daily low-voltage power outages in South Korea for five consecutive years. This surge in instability creates a stark contradiction as the government prepares to transform the area into a global semiconductor powerhouse.
Data reveals a sharp climb in grid failures, with low-voltage outages rising from 29,294 cases in 2021 to 38,302 in 2025, representing a 30.8% growth rate over four years. The region's share of nationwide low-voltage outages grew from 12.2% to 15.9% during the same period. While KEPCO initially pointed to natural disasters, the figures show structural decay is the primary driver: outages caused by aging or faulty equipment soared 57.9%, from 6,893 to 10,885 cases, while failures due to exceeding contracted electricity capacity jumped 55.8%, from 9,209 to 14,346 cases.
The Honam Ambition
This infrastructure crisis arrives as Seoul aggressively expands its semiconductor footprint beyond the Gyeonggi region. The government has tapped the Gwangju Military Airport site for the Honam semiconductor cluster, a project slated to begin in 2030. The plan involves an estimated investment of over 800 trillion won, with industry giants Samsung Electronics and SK hynix expected to construct four fabrication plants. The project is not without friction, as it requires the relocation of a military base used by the U.S. Air Force during contingencies, adding geopolitical complexity to the logistical challenge.
A Critical Infrastructure Gap
While the planned chip factories will utilize dedicated ultra-high-voltage grids to ensure stability, the surrounding ecosystem remains vulnerable. The influx of suppliers, logistics providers, and residential populations required to support the cluster will rely on the existing distribution network, which is currently failing. Rep. Kim Wi Sang of the People Power Party noted that the region, once claimed to have surplus electricity, now leads the nation in low-voltage outages, exposing a fundamental structural instability that must be addressed.
Risks to Economic Stability
The gap between high-tech industrial ambitions and decaying electrical infrastructure poses a systemic risk. If the distribution network is not modernized, the sudden increase in demand from supporting industries could trigger widespread grid failure. Such a scenario would not only jeopardize the 800 trillion won investment but also threaten the broader economic stability of the region.
What to Watch
Attention now turns to whether the government will integrate distribution network modernization into the Honam cluster's timeline. While the fabrication plants themselves are protected by dedicated lines, the viability of the entire industrial hub depends on the stability of the local grid. It remains to be seen if KEPCO and regional authorities can accelerate equipment replacement and capacity upgrades before the 2030 rollout.
